UWW Postpones 2026 World Wrestling Championships Scheduled For Bahrain In Oct-Nov
"United World Wrestling (UWW), in close coordination with the Bahrain Olympic Committee and the Bahrain Wrestling Federation, announces the postponement of the 2026 World Championships originally scheduled to take place from October 24 to November 1 in the Kingdom of Bahrain," said the sport's global governing body in a statement on Friday.
This decision was taken after careful and responsible consideration of the current geopolitical situation in the region, particularly the ongoing uncertainty surrounding the pending conflict involving the Gulf region and its broader impact on regional stability and international travel, the statement said.
